diff options
author | Matthew Heon <matthew.heon@gmail.com> | 2018-02-16 15:18:31 -0500 |
---|---|---|
committer | Atomic Bot <atomic-devel@projectatomic.io> | 2018-02-19 14:17:18 +0000 |
commit | 07f15c26945eada770a30655b43cadcbb62bf2ae (patch) | |
tree | c825bf0d223ef9aea4f857d212528c6fd61bf3ec | |
parent | 5317ba792c30e4e32a117c16c44064bec4030001 (diff) | |
download | podman-07f15c26945eada770a30655b43cadcbb62bf2ae.tar.gz podman-07f15c26945eada770a30655b43cadcbb62bf2ae.tar.bz2 podman-07f15c26945eada770a30655b43cadcbb62bf2ae.zip |
Remove unused registry related options from libpod
Signed-off-by: Matthew Heon <matthew.heon@gmail.com>
Closes: #349
Approved by: rhatdan
-rw-r--r-- | libpod/options.go | 12 | ||||
-rw-r--r-- | libpod/runtime.go | 2 |
2 files changed, 2 insertions, 12 deletions
diff --git a/libpod/options.go b/libpod/options.go index 9d0d63777..56e8fa203 100644 --- a/libpod/options.go +++ b/libpod/options.go @@ -45,10 +45,8 @@ func WithStorageConfig(config storage.StoreOptions) RuntimeOption { } } -// WithImageConfig uses the given configuration to set up image handling -// If this is not specified, the system default configuration will be used -// instead -func WithImageConfig(defaultTransport string, insecureRegistries, registries []string) RuntimeOption { +// WithDefaultTransport sets the default transport for retrieving images +func WithDefaultTransport(defaultTransport string) RuntimeOption { return func(rt *Runtime) error { if rt.valid { return ErrRuntimeFinalized @@ -56,12 +54,6 @@ func WithImageConfig(defaultTransport string, insecureRegistries, registries []s rt.config.ImageDefaultTransport = defaultTransport - rt.config.InsecureRegistries = make([]string, len(insecureRegistries)) - copy(rt.config.InsecureRegistries, insecureRegistries) - - rt.config.Registries = make([]string, len(registries)) - copy(rt.config.Registries, registries) - return nil } } diff --git a/libpod/runtime.go b/libpod/runtime.go index 6e26b0f1b..894e4b4d0 100644 --- a/libpod/runtime.go +++ b/libpod/runtime.go @@ -58,8 +58,6 @@ type Runtime struct { type RuntimeConfig struct { StorageConfig storage.StoreOptions ImageDefaultTransport string - InsecureRegistries []string - Registries []string SignaturePolicyPath string StateType RuntimeStateStore RuntimePath string |